Healey | Quite numerous: Ulster only. See Healy. |
Healy | Very numerous: all areas: particularly Munster, least in Ulster. Ir. Ó h-Éalaighthe, from ealadhach, ingenious. This was a family in Muskerry (Cork). A separate grouping in N Connacht were Ó h-Éilidhe (claimant). IF & SGG. |
Heeley | rare: Cork, Clare etc. See Healy. |
Hely | Very rare: scattered. The Hely-Hutchinsons are a noted branch of the Healys of Muskerry. |
